2019 SOS to GNF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2019

During 2019, the SOS to GNF ex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on December 31, valuing the pair at 16.5032.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on November 12, dropping to 15.5908.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.9124 GNF.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 15.7866 to the December average rate of 16.3484, the exchange rate registered a net change of 3.56%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2019 high of 16.5032 was up 3.84% compared to the 2018 peak of 15.8930,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.
